Within the framework of the Ukrainian operation "Web", the Czech Republic played a key role, putting on Ukraine has special explosives that were used to attack Russian aircraft. The Czech information resource Respect writes about this today, June 23.
One of the sources of the publication stated:
"Explosives from the Czech Republic were used."
Another, allegedly familiar with the details of the entire operation, added:
"Yes, these were domestic [Czech] components."
According to Respect, we are talking about a special type of explosive "Razor semtex", which acts as an "explosive razor".
"Thanks to this, drones could destroy Russian aircraft even more effectively, hitting them with surgical precision. This type of explosive is produced by the Czech company "Explosion", but a spokeswoman for the company did not want to comment on these reports, citing security measures. The Minister of Industry and Trade of the Czech Republic Lukas Vlcek spoke in a similar tone," writes Respect.
